Ferrari video of the next Enzo's HY-KERS hybrid

Thu, 26 Apr 2012

Ferrari has issued video of its new HY-KERS hybrid system bound for the new Enzo successor due later in 2012. It mates a V12 petrol engine with a brace of electric motors - one to drive the car's ancillary systems like cooling and power assistance, and the larger one to drive the rear wheels. This teaser video doesn't give away any incredible performance figures, but it does afford a glimpse into Maranello's thinking for its new hypercar.

Caterham Seven 160 (2013) first official pictures

Tue, 22 Oct 2013

By Ollie Kew First Official Pictures 22 October 2013 11:30 In an era when we’re all crying out for lighter, less complicated, more fuel efficient cars (at a moderately affordable price) here’s the model enthusiasts have surely been waiting for: the new Caterham Seven 160. Despite developing just 80bhp from its turbocharged 660cc Suzuki engine, the Seven 160 will scamper to 60mph in just 6.5sec. Read on for the full spec of this hero of downsizing.

Buick Encore video gives us a proper look at the Opel / Vauxhall Mokka

Fri, 20 Jan 2012

Buick Encore video previews the new Vauxhall Mokka The Vauxhall/Opel Mokka may not arrive until Geneva 2012, but we get a good look at what’s on offer in this Buick Encore video. The whole ‘World Car’ phenomenon that’s sprung out of the mire of the financial woes of the US car industry does lead to a few anomalies. Like the Buick Encore being revealed in the States whilst Europe has only had a couple of photos of the Opel / Vauxhall Mokka ahead of its debut at the 2012 Geneva Motor Show in March.
